Crisp and Refreshing: The Ultimate Cucumber and Carrot Salad Recipe

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ale

  • 1 large cucumber, thinly sliced
  • 2 large carrots, julienned
  • 1/4 cup fresh dill,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1/2 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• Optional: 1/4 cup toasted sesame seeds for garnish

Instructions

  1. Start by preparing your vegetables. Slice the cucumber thinly and julienne the carrots. If you have a mandoline, this process is a breeze, but a sharp knife and steady hand work just as well.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cucumber, carrots, and chopped dill. Toss gently to mix.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, apple cider vinegar, honey, sea salt, and black pepper until the dressing is well emulsified.
  4. Pour the dressing over the vegetables and toss until everything is evenly coated. This is where your trusty wooden spoon comes in handy — it stirs as if it remembers all the meals it has helped create.
  5. If desired, sprinkle toasted sesame seeds over the top for added texture and a nutty flavor.
  6. Let the salad sit for at least 10 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ld together. A bit of patience here goes a long way in enhancing the taste.
